版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
1、试卷第 1页,总 19页程序框图程序框图练习题(一)练习题(一)一、选择题一、选择题1阅读右图所示的程序框图,运行相应的程序,输出的结果是A2B4C8D162如图所示,程序框图(算法流程图)的输出结果是()A、3B、4C、D、3阅读右边的程序框图,运行相应的程序,当输入 x 的值为-25 时,输出 x 的值为试卷第 2页,总 19页开始输入 x|x|11|xxx = 2x+1输出 x结束是否A、-1B、1C、3D、94如图的程序框图,如果输入三个实数a,b,c,要求输出这三个数中最大的数,那么在空白的判断框中,应该填入下面四个选项中的()开始输入abc, ,xabxxbxc输出x结束是是否否A
2、cxBxcCcbDbc5 某店一个月的收入和支出总共记录了 N 个数据1a,2a, 。 。 。Na, 其中收入记为正数,支出记为负数。该店用如下图的程序框图计算月总收入 S 和月净盈利 V,那么在图中空白的判断框和处理框中,应分别填入下列四个选项中的试卷第 3页,总 19页A、A0,VSTB、A0,VSTC、A0, VSTD、A0, VST6图 1 是某县参加 2007 年高考的学生身高条形统计图,从左到右的各条形图表示学生人数依次记为 A1、A2、A10(如 A2表示身高(单位:cm)在150,155)内的人数。图2 是统计图 1 中身高在一定范围内学生人数的一个算法流程图。现要统计身高在1
3、60180cm(含 160cm,不含 180cm)的学生人数,那么在流程图中的判断框内应填写的条件是A、i6B、i7C、i8D、 i115?结束否是输出 kA(20,25B(30,32C(28,57D(30,578由右图所示的流程图可得结果为试卷第 4页,总 19页否是开始10is,iss3 ii?19i输出结束A、19B、 64C、51D、709执行右边的程序框图,输出的结果是18,则处应填入的条件是()A.2?K B.3?K C.4?K D.5?K 10若程序框图如图所示,则该程序运行后输出k的值是()试卷第 5页,总 19页开始2nn 否n3n+1n 为偶数kk1结束n5,k0是输出 k
4、n =1?否是A.4B.5C.6D.711某医院今年 1 月份至 6 月份中,每个月因为感冒来就诊的人数如下表所示:月份 i123456因感冒就诊人数1a2a3a4a5a6a如图是统计该院这 6 个月因感冒来就诊人数总数的程序框图,则图中判断框应填,执行框应填A6i ;issaB6i ;isaC6i ;issaD6i ;12isaaa12下列程序的运算结果为试卷第 6页,总 19页A. 20B. 15C. 10D. 516C14执行如图的程序框图,若输出的5 n,则输入整数p的最小值是()输出n开始10nS,Sp?是输入 p结束12nS S 否1nnA. 15B. 14C. 7D. 815一名
5、中学生在家庭范围内推广“节水工程”做饭、淘米、洗菜的水留下来擦地或浇花,洗涮的水留下来冲卫生间(如图) ,该图示称为()洗涮用水做饭、淘米、洗菜用水自来水冲卫生间用水擦地、浇花用水A流程图B程序框图C组织结构图D知识结构图16把 89 化成五进制数的末位数字为()试卷第 7页,总 19页A.1B.2C.3D.417某程序框图如图所示,该程序运行后输出的值是()A3B4C5D618如图,是一个程序框图,运行这个程序,则输出的结果为A.1321B.2113C.813D.13819已知实数0,8x,执行如右图所示的程序框图,则输出的x不小于 55 的概率为【】A14B12C34D5420如图所示,输
6、出的n为()A.10B.11C.12D.13试卷第 8页,总 19页21以下给出的是计算111124620的值的一个程序框图,如右图所示,其中判断框内应填入的条件是()A10i B10i C20i D20i 开始s=0, n=2, i=1s= s+ 1/nn=n+2i=i+1是否输出 S结束22 给出右边的程序框图,则输出的结果为()A、76B、65C、87D、54试卷第 9页,总 19页23如果执行右面的程序框图,如果输出的2550S,则判断框处为()A?50kB?51kC?50kD?51k开始1k 0S 是2SSk1kk否输出S结束24阅读如图所示的某一问题的算法的流程图,此流程图反映的算
7、法功能是()A.求出cba,三个数中的最大数B.求出cba,三个数中的最小数C.将cba,按从大到小排列D.将cba,按从小到大排列试卷第 10页,总 19页?输出?开始?结束?是?否?输入?是?否25按如图的流程,可打印出一个数列,设这个数列为xn,则 x4=()A43B85C1611D322126右图中,x1,x2,x3为某次考试三个评阅人对同一道题的独立评分,p 为该题的最终得分,当 x16,x29,p8.5 时,x3等于试卷第 11页,总 19页A11B10C8D727在如下程序框图中,已知:xxexf)(0,则输出的是()Axxxee 2009Bxxxee 2008Cxxxee 20
8、07Dxex200828如下图所示的程序框图中,如果输入三个实数为 a3,b7,c,则输出结果为()A2B3C7Dx试卷第 12页,总 19页29把 389 化为四进制数的末位为()A.1B.2C.3D.030执行右图的程序框图,输出的结果是 18,则处应填入的条件是()AK2BK3CK4DK531.阅读右图的程序框图, 若输出S的值等于16, 那么在程序框图中的判断框内应填写的条件是()A5i?B6i?C7i?D8i?试卷第 13页,总 19页32执行右面的程序框图,如果输入的 n 是 4,则输出的 P 是()A.8B.5C.3D.233执行右侧的程序框图,则输出的s的值为()A.16B.1
9、0C.8D.234某程序框图如图所示,若输出的 S57,则判断框内为()试卷第 14页,总 19页Ak4Bk5Ck6Dk735右图给出的是计算111124620的值的一个框图,其中菱形判断框内应填入的条件是()A10iB10iC11iD11i36执行如图 212 所示的程序框图,如果输入 p5,则输出的 S()图 212试卷第 15页,总 19页A1516B3116C3132D633237算法的有穷性是指()A 算法必须包含输出B算法中每个操作步骤都是可执行的C 算法的步骤必须有限D以上说法均不正确38在下图中,直到型循环结构为()39执行如图所示的程序框图,输出的 S 值为()A252(41
10、)3B262(41)3C5021D512140执行如图所示的程序框图,输出的 s 值为()A3B12C13D二、填空题二、填空题试卷第 16页,总 19页41程序框图(即算法流程图)如图所示,其输出结果是_.开始1a 21aa100?a 输出a结束是否42(2009 山东卷理)执行右边的程序框图,输出的 T=.开始S=0,T=0,n=0TSS=S+5n=n+2T=T+n输出 T结束是否43 某算法的程序框图如右图所示, 则输出量y与输入量x满足的关系式是44阅读如图所示的程序框图,运行相应的程序,输出的结果s .试卷第 17页,总 19页45下图是一个算法流程图,则输出的 k 的值是46若程序
11、框图如图所示,则该程序运行后输出的值是_47阅读右图所示的程序框图,运行相应地程序,输出的 s 值等于_试卷第 18页,总 19页48如图所示,程序框图(算法流程图)的输出结果49阅读右边的程序框图,该程序输出的结果是开始1,1as4?a 9ss 1aas输出结束否是50程序框图(算法流程图)如图所示,其输出结果A试卷第 19页,总 19页开始A=1k=1B=2A+1A=Bk=k+1k5?输出A结束是否答案第 1页,总 9页参考答案参考答案1C【解析】由程序框图可知:当1s 时,2n ;当12s 时,4n ;当2s 时,8n ,故选 C。2B【解析】x1248y12343C【解析】解:当输入
12、x=-25 时,|x|1,执行循环,x=| 25|-1=4;|x|=41,执行循环,x=| 4|-1=1,|x|=1,退出循环,输出的结果为 x=21+1=3故选 C【考点定位】本题考查流程图,考查学生的分析问题的能力【答案】A【解析】变量x的作用是保留 3 个数中的最大值,所以第二个条件结构的判断框内语句为“cx” ,满足“是”则交换两个变量的数值后输出x的值结束程序,满足“否”直接输出x的值结束程序。5C【解析】月总收入为 S,因此 A0 时归入 S,判断框内填 A0支出 T 为负数,因此月盈利 VST6C【解析】考查算法的基本运用。现要统计的是身高在 160-180cm 之间的学生的人数
13、,即是要计算 A4、A5、A6、A7的和,故流程图中空白框应是 i8,当 i8 时就会返回进行叠加运算,当 i8 将数据直接输出,不再进行任何的返回叠加运算,此时已把数据 A4、A5、A6、A7叠加起来送到 S 中输出,故选 C。7C【解析】试题分析:当输出 k2 时,应满足21 1152(21) 1115xx ,得 2810”故选 A22A【解析】解:k=1,S=0+12=12,满足条件 k5,执行循环k=2,S=12+16=23,满足条件 k5,执行循环k=3,S=23+112=34,满足条件 k5,执行循环k=4,S=45,满足条件 k5,执行循环k=5,S=56,满足条件 k5,执行循
14、环k=6,S=67,不满足条件 k5,退出循环输出 S=67,故选 A.23A【解析】因为解:根据题意可知该循环体运行 5 次第一次:k=2,s=2,答案第 5页,总 9页第二次:k=3,s=2+4,第三次:k=4,s=2+4+6,第四次:k=5,s=2+4+6+8,因为 k=50,结束循环,输出结果 S=2550则判断框里面应该填写?50k,选 A.24B【解析】解:条件结构叠加,程序执行时需依次对“条件 1”、“条件 2”、“条件 3”都进行判断,只有遇到能满足的条件才执行该条件对应的操作根据流程图可知当 ab 时取 b,当 bc 时取 c 可知求三个数中最小的数,故选 B25C【解析】解
15、:分析程序中各变量、各语句的作用,再根据流程图所示的顺序,可知:该程序的作用是:输出 i100 时,打印 x 值程序在运行过程中各变量的情况如下表示:i a b x 是否继续循环循环前 1 0 112是第一圈 2 11 32 4是第二圈 31 3 52 4 8是第三圈 43 5114 816是,故选 C26C【解析】解:根据提供的该算法的程序框图,该题的最后得分是三个分数中差距小的两个分数的平均分根据 x1=6,x2=9,不满足|x1-x2|2,故进入循环体,输入 x3,判断 x3与 x1,x2哪个数差距小,差距小的那两个数的平均数作为该题的最后得分因此由 8.5=39x2,解出 x3=8故选
16、 C27B【解析】解:程序在运行过程中各变量的值如下表示:i fi(x) 是否继续循环循环前 0 xex第一圈 1 (1+x)ex是第二圈 2 (2+x)ex是第三圈 3 (3+x)ex是第 n 圈 1 (n+x)ex/第 2008 圈 (2008+x)ex否故输出的结果为:2008ex+xex故答案为:B28C【解析】由于该程序的作用输出 a、b、c 中的最大数,因此在程序中要比较数与数的大小,答案第 6页,总 9页第一个判断框是判断最大值 x 与 b 的大小,故第二个判断框一定是判断最大值 x 与 c 的大小因此可知输出的结果为选项 C29A【解析】 因为104(389)(12011),所
17、以末位 为 1.30A【解析】解:当 K=1 时,不满足条件,执行循环,S=2+8=10,K=2;不满足条件,执行循环,S=10+8=18,K=3;满足条件,退出循环,输出 S=18故处应填入的条件是 K2 或 K3故选 A31A【解析】因为 S=1+1=2,i=2,不满足条件,执行循环;S=2+2=4,i=3,不满足条件,执行循环;S=4+3=7,i=4,不满足条件,执行循环;S=7+4=11,i=5,不满足条件,执行循环;S=11+5=16,i=6,满足条件,退出循环体,输出 S=16故判定框中应填 i5 或 i6故选:A32C【解析】 退出循环体时 k=4,所以共执 行了两次循环 体,则
18、 p=3.33B【解析】 由于退出 循环体时 i=3,所以其执 行了两次循环 体, 所以2810S .34A【解析】程序在运行过程中各变量值变化如下表:KS是否继续循环循环前 11第一圈 24是第二圈 311是第三圈426是第四圈557否故退出循环的条件应为 k4.35A【解析】经过第一次循环得到 S=12,i=2,此时的 i 应该不满足判断框中的条件,经过第二次循环得到1124S ,i=3,此时的 i 应该不满足判断框中的条件,经过第三次循环得到111246S ,i=4,此时的 i 应该不满足判断框中的条件,经过第十次循环得到1111.24620S ,i=11,此时的 i 应该满足判断框中的
19、条件,执行输出,故判断框中的条件是 i10.36C答案第 7页,总 9页【 解 析 】 由 图 可 以 看 出 , 循 环 体 被 执 行 五 次 , 第 n 次 执 行 , 对 S 作 的 运 算 就是加进2n,故512345111 ( ) 31222222213212S.37C【解析】算法的有穷性是指算法的步骤必须有限.38A【解析】 直到型循环结 构是满足条件 就退出循环体.故应选 A.39A【解析】因为退出循环时k=51,所以输出的252535492(1 4 )2(41)222.21 43S.40D【解析】i=0,满足条 件 i4,执行循 环体, i=1, s=13,满足条件 i4,执
20、行循环 体,i=2,s=-12满足条件 i4,执行循 环体, i=3, s=-3满足条件 i4,执行循 环体,i=4,s=2不满足条 件 i4,退出循 环体,此时 s=2.故选:D41127【解析】由程序框图知,循环体被执行后a的值依次为 3、7、15、31、63、127,故输出的结果是 127。4230【解析】:按照程序框图依次执行为 S=5,n=2,T=2;S=10,n=4,T=2+4=6;S=15,n=6,T=6+6=12;S=20,n=8,T=12+8=20;S=25,n=10,T=20+10=30S,输出 T=30答案:30【命题立意】:本题主要考查了循环结构的程序框图,一般都可以反
21、复的进行运算直到满足条件结束,本题中涉及到三个变量,注意每个变量的运行结果和执行情况.432 (1)2(1)xxyxx【解析】根据框图,当输入的x的值满足条件1x 时,2yx,不满足条件1x 时,2xy ,即当1x 时,2xy .x的取值范围不同,y有不同的表达式,故这是一个分段函数.449【解析】当1,1an时,计算出的1s ;当3,2an时,计算出的4s ;当5,3an答案第 8页,总 9页时,计算出的9s ,此时输出的结果 s=9.【考点定位】本小题考查框图的基本知识.框图是高考的热点内容之一,年年必考,经常以选择或填空题的形式出现一个,难度不大,熟练基本算法以及算到哪一步是解决好本类问题的关键.455。【解析】根据流程图所示的顺序,程序的运行过程中变量值变化如下表:是否继续循环k2k5k4循环前00第一圈是10第二圈是22第三圈是32第四圈是40第五圈是54第六圈否输出 5最终输出结果 k=5【考点】程序框图。461120【解析】T,i 关系
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2025年度个人家政服务长期合作协议
- 二零二五版马赛克个性化定制服务合同4篇
- 2025版天然气供应合同争议解决机制范本模板3篇
- 二零二五年度环保设施建设合同样本4篇
- 2025年度全国牛羊肉批发市场联动购销合同
- 二零二五版林木种子繁殖与推广合同4篇
- 2025年度高层住宅劳务作业分包合同实施细则
- 2025年度离婚后知识产权归属及使用合同3篇
- 2025版工业用地购置与房屋租赁合同
- 二零二五年度企业品牌形象设计合同-@-1
- 贵州省2024年中考英语真题(含答案)
- 施工项目平移合同范本
- 家具生产车间规章制度
- (高清版)JTGT 3360-01-2018 公路桥梁抗风设计规范
- 胰岛素注射的护理
- 云南省普通高中学生综合素质评价-基本素质评价表
- 2024年消防产品项目营销策划方案
- 闻道课件播放器
- 03轴流式压气机b特性
- 五星级酒店收入测算f
- 大数据与人工智能ppt
评论
0/150
提交评论